How they compare

North Macedonia currently reports 756.8 Per 1 000 000 inhabitants against 647.27 Per 1 000 000 inhabitants in Hungary, a difference of 109.53 Per 1 000 000 inhabitants.

That makes North Macedonia's figure about 1.2 times Hungary's.

Across all 20 years both countries report, North Macedonia has been ahead every year.

Hungary ranks 9th and North Macedonia ranks 6th of 168 countries.

North Macedonia has averaged higher in every one of the 2 decades both report.

The Statistical Annex to the annual Africa's Development Dynamics (AFDD) report is a collection of development indicators that were gathered and analysed while conducting the research that went into the report. These data are also available online for free viewing or download at https://oe.cd/AFDD-2024, a bilingual website which links to the electronic version of the Africa's Development Dynamics book in both English and French. Table 30 shows the economic costs of premature deaths caused by various environmental hazards, such as air pollution, unsafe water, and high and low temperatures.
